Exploring Diverse Roofing Supplies

When contemplating a new roof, homeowners need to understand the numerous roofing materials available, as each option delivers distinct benefits and challenges. Asphalt shingles are among the most widely used due to their budget-friendly nature and ease of installation. They offer a respectable lifespan and come in diverse colors and styles. Metal roofing, notable for its durability and energy efficiency, can withstand extreme weather conditions but may have a higher preliminary cost. Clay and slate tiles provide a classic aesthetic and longevity, yet they are heavier and often require reinforced roof structures. Wood shakes and shingles provide natural beauty and insulation but necessitate more maintenance. Finally, synthetic materials can imitate the appearance of traditional options while minimizing weight and boosting durability. Each roofing material has specific characteristics, making it essential for homeowners to meticulously consider their priorities, budget, and local climate when making a decision.

Signs Your Roof Requires Repair Work

Understanding the indicators that a roof demands repairs read the information is essential for preserving the integrity of a home. Homeowners should be alert to visible shingle damage, water leaks throughout the property, and the presence of granules in the gutters. Tackling these issues promptly can stop more extensive damage and costly repairs in the future.

Apparent Shingles Harm

A substantial number of homeowners might ignore visible shingle damage, yet it serves as a essential indicator that a roof needs attention. Indicators such as cracked, missing, or curled shingles can signal underlying issues that may escalate over time. Discoloration, often caused by algae or moss growth, can also undermine the roof's integrity. Homeowners should periodically inspect their roofs, particularly after severe weather events, to spot any indications of damage early. Tackling visible shingle damage without delay can prevent more significant repairs and pricey replacements in the future. Furthermore, a well-maintained roof improves a home's curb appeal and overall value, making it crucial for homeowners to remain vigilant about the quality of their roofing materials.

Water Leaks Inside

How can homeowners detect water leaks inside their homes? They should be vigilant for specific signs indicating potential roof damage. Ceiling and wall stains commonly signal water infiltration. Homeowners may also notice peeling paint or wallpaper, which can result from prolonged moisture exposure. Furthermore, a damp smell can suggest mold development from concealed water seepage. Property owners ought to inspect attic spaces for moisture in insulation or damp areas that indicate roofing problems. Moreover, water droplets appearing during rainfall represent an obvious sign of roofing system breakdown. Early detection of these symptoms is crucial, allowing property owners to contact trusted roofing professionals before small issues become major repairs. Taking preventive measures ensures a secure and moisture-free home.

Granules in Gutters

When property owners observe granules collecting in their gutters, it often signals that their roof could be in need of repairs. These granules are usually composed of the protective layer of asphalt shingles, which can break down over time due to exposure to the elements. Their presence in gutters reveals that the roof is losing its integrity, potentially even leading to leaks and more damage. Homeowners should examine their roofs for extra signs, such as missing or curled shingles, and contemplate seeking professional assistance. Ignoring the accumulation of granules can cause more significant issues, including pricey repairs or even the need for a complete roof replacement. Timely intervention can help maintain the roof's lifespan and protect the home from water damage.

Energy-Saving Roofing Options

What factors contribute to energy-efficient roofing solutions? Multiple important factors play a vital part in enhancing a home's energy efficiency. First, the selection of roofing material is vital; materials such as metal, clay tiles, and certain asphalt shingles can reflect sunlight, reducing heat absorption. Additionally, adequate insulation beneath the roof helps keep indoor temperatures, decreasing the dependency on heating and cooling systems. Ventilation is another crucial factor, as it permits hot air to escape, eliminating heat buildup in the attic. The roof's color also influences energy efficiency; lighter colors generally reflect more sunlight, causing lower cooling costs. Moreover, the installation of reflective coatings can improve a roof's efficiency. These solutions not only contribute to reduced energy consumption but may also bring about lower utility bills, making energy-efficient roofing an desirable option for homeowners seeking to invest in sustainable living.

Choosing the Best Roofing Company

How can homeowners be certain they choose a reputable roofing contractor? First, they should ask for recommendations from friends, family, or neighbors who have recently completed roofing projects. Online reviews and ratings can also give helpful perspectives into a contractor's reputation. It's crucial for homeowners to verify that the contractor is insured and licensed, protecting them from potential liabilities.

Property owners should request various estimates, ensuring they understand the extent of work and materials included. A trustworthy contractor will provide a comprehensive written proposal and be willing to answer concerns.

In addition, verifying the contractor's references helps homeowners to gauge past work quality and customer satisfaction. Participating in a thorough interview process can additionally demonstrate the contractor's expertise and professionalism. In the end, by performing diligent research and asking the right questions, homeowners can make knowledgeable decisions, ensuring they select a roofing contractor who addresses their needs and expectations.

What's the Typical Duration for a Roofing Project?

An average roofing project generally takes between one to three weeks to complete. Elements affecting the timeline include the project's size, weather conditions, and the roofing materials used, which can impact the overall progress and efficiency.

What Kind of Warranties Are Provided for Roofing Services?

Different warranties are accessible for roofing services, including product warranties covering materials and workmanship warranties from contractors. These warranties typically range from 5 to 30 years, ensuring protection against issues and early failures.

Is Installing a New Roof Over My Existing One Possible?

Installing a fresh roof above an existing one is feasible, but it relies on area building codes, the structural integrity of the existing roof, and the style of materials used. Consulting a professional is recommended.

How Do I Prepare My Home for a Roofing Project?

When preparing for a roofing project, homeowners should clear the space around their home, move outdoor furniture and decorations, make certain of access for workers, and confine pets indoors, establishing a safe and efficient work environment.

What Roof Repair Financing Options Are Available?

Various financing solutions for roof repairs include personal loans, home equity loans, and specialized contractor financing. Moreover, some homeowners may be eligible for government grants or assistance programs focused on home improvement and maintenance.
